Course overview

The CIPD Level 5 Diploma in Organisational Learning and Development is a professional qualification equivalent to an undergraduate degree.

Enrol on a level 5 course and gain practical insights into a wider breadth of L&D subjects, including organisational performance and evidence-based practice, to progress your expertise and advance your career.

Successfully completing the CIPD Level 5 L&D Diploma will open up your career opportunities and allow you to study at the Advanced Level. You will also be eligible for the Associate Level of CIPD Membership, providing exclusive networking opportunities.

Duration study load

On average it takes 9 to 12 months to complete

Entry requirements

There are no formal entry requirements for you to enrol. However, this qualification is designed for learners aged 18+ and you should meet the requirements of the learning outcomes and have the appropriate literacy and numeracy needed to complete the CIPD Level 5 Associate Diploma.

Assessment

You’ll complete written assignments for each module and submit them online to be marked by our assessors. CIPD will review all your assignments before awarding your qualification.

Choosing the right qualification

The Associate Diploma in Organisational L&D is suited to individuals who are aspiring to, or embarking on, a career in L&D; are working in an L&D role and wish to contribute their knowledge and skills to help shape organisational value; are working towards or working in a managerial role.

Subjects

You will extend your level of understanding by studying a wide breadth of L&D subjects, progressing your expertise in L&D to help you advance your career.

It consists of 3 core units, 3 specialist units plus 1 optional unit.

Core Units
Core Unit 1 L5CO1
Organisational performance and culture in practice

This unit examines the connections between the organisational structure and the wider world of work in a commercial context. It highlights the factors and trends, including the digital environment, that impact on business strategy and workforce planning; recognising the influence of culture, employee wellbeing and behaviour in delivering change and organisational performance.

Core Unit 2 L5CO2
Evidence based practice

This unit addresses the significance of capturing robust quantitative and qualitative evidence to inform meaningful insight to influence critical thinking. It focuses on analysing evidence through an ethical lens to improve decision-making and how measuring the impact of people practice is essential in creating value.

Core Unit 3 L5CO3
Professional behaviours and valuing people

This unit focuses on how applying core professional behaviours such as ethical practice, courage and inclusivity can build positive working relationships and supports employee voice and well-being. It considers how developing and mastering new professional behaviours and practice can impact performance.

Specialist Units
Specialist Unit 1 L5SL1
Supporting self-directed and social learning

This unit is about recognising how individuals are increasingly wanting to learn at their own pace, by their preferred method, and in a way that fits with their personal schedules and lifestyle. Moreover, effective organisational learning embraces formal and informal socialising activities. These shifts, and the greater recognition of the benefits in driving performance through learning means that learning and development professionals must facilitate approaches for those who learn in these ways.

Specialist Unit 2 L5SL2
Learning and development design to create value

This unit considers the relationship between the learning and development needs of individuals and organisational objectives. It focuses on the elements of theoretical and contextual learning design in facilitating impactful learning experiences that support performance and productivity.

Specialist Unit 3 L5SL3
Facilitate personalised and performance focused learning

This unit focuses on the effective facilitation of learning activities that have an impact. This includes knowing how to prepare an impactful intervention, making effective use of pre-learning activities and personalisation to create learning that can be transferred back into the organisational context. In addition, it explores facilitation techniques, whether face-to-face or online, and the principles and ethics that underpin the delivery of an outstanding learning experience

Optional Units
Learners will select ONE from a possible six of the following

Optional Unit 1 L5OS1 Specialist employment law

This unit considers key areas of employment legislation and its legal framework, focusing on how people professionals are obliged to take account of legal requirements in different jurisdictions when carrying out the varied aspects of their role.

Optional Unit 2 L5OS2 Advances in digital learning and development

This unit focuses on how digital technology can be used to enhance learning and development engagement. It looks at existing and emerging learning technologies, how the use of digital content and curation is designed to maximise interaction and the value of online learning communities.

Optional Unit 4 L5OS4 People management in an international context

This unit is designed to give those practitioners working in People Management in an international context, the opportunity to focus on the complexities and considerations essential to this.

Optional Unit 5 L5OS5 Diversity and Inclusion

This unit focuses on how adapting leadership styles to manage, monitor and report on equality and diversity is essential for inclusive practice and legislation. The importance of promoting a diverse and inclusive workforce to drive a positive culture and celebrate diversity and inclusion increases organisational performance as well as meeting the needs of employees and customers more effectively.

Optional Unit 7 L5OS7 Leadership management development

This unit builds on the fundamentals of learning and development, taking a closer look at the essential area of leadership and management and how this is critical in developing the right culture and behaviours to establish a working environment which is cohesive, diverse, innovative and high performing. Choosing the right tools and approaches to facilitate development will ultimately impact organisational effectiveness.

Optional Unit 8 L5OS8 Well-being at work

This unit introduces well-being and its importance in the workplace.  It explores existing links between work, health and well-being examining how to manage well-being and how it links with other areas of people management practice, and wider organisational strategy.  The unit considers key elements of well-being programmes and the stakeholders involved, examining organisational responsibilities and the outcomes of managing well-being for employees and employers.
